Public domain documents released by the Republican staff of the House Judiciary Committee prior to the 2022 midterms. A roadmap for likely investigations. Enhanced by Cincinnatus [AI].Explain It To Me Like I’m Five Years Old: The FBI and DOJ are being criticized by some people. These people think that the FBI and DOJ are not doing their jobs properly.TL;DR: 'The FBI and DOJ are being accused of bias against Trump. nThe FBI and DOJ are denying these accusations.'Recursive Summary[n-1]: 'The FBI is being accused of inflating statistics, manipulating case categorization, and violating privacy rules. Meanwhile, the DOJ is being criticized for its handling of an investigation into possible illegal meetings between parents and school officials, and left-wing anarchists in Portland have developed a riot apparatus that has resulted in murder and damage to federal property.'Cover art: [House Republican investigation of the Biden Administration; hostile cartoon; sketch; grayscale; herblock style] (Nimble Books, using Stable Diffusion).
